File: bash_completion

package info (click to toggle)
ifscheme 1.7-6
  • links: PTS
  • area: main
  • in suites: bullseye
  • size: 240 kB
  • sloc: sh: 925; makefile: 5
file content (7 lines) | stat: -rw-r--r-- 237 bytes parent folder | download | duplicates (4)
1
2
3
4
5
6
7
_ifscheme()
{
	cur=${COMP_WORDS[COMP_CWORD]}
	schemes=$( cat /etc/network/interfaces | grep "iface.*-.*inet" | cut -d ' ' -f 2 | cut -d '-' -f 2 | sort )
	COMPREPLY=( $( compgen -W "$schemes" -- $cur ) )
}
complete -F _ifscheme ifscheme